Inspired by cioppino, a hearty Italian-American shellfish stew, this velvety seafood soup is enhanced by a mix of tangy-sweet roasted red pepper pesto and luscious cream. Juicy shrimp seasoned with paprika and garlic get a touch of heat from a sprinkle of red pepper flakes.

- Peel, then cut onion into 1/4-inch pieces.
- Trim ends off broccolini, then cut into 2-inch pieces.
- Cut celery into 1/4-inch pieces.
- Using a strainer, drain and rinse shrimp. Pat dry with paper towels. Remove and discard shrimp tails. Season with salt and pepper.
- Add shrimp, Smoked Paprika-Garlic Blend and 1/2 tbsp (1 tbsp) oil to a large bowl. Season with salt and pepper, then toss to coat. Set aside.
- Heat a large pot over medium heat. When hot, add 2 tbsp (4 tbsp) butter, then onion, broccolini and celery. Cook, stirring often, until veggies are tender crisp, 5-6 min.
- Add cream, roasted red pepper pesto and 1 cup (2 cups) water.
- Reduce heat to medium low. Cook, stirring occasionally, until soup thickens slightly, 3-4 min.
- Add shrimp and garlic puree to the large pot with cream and veggie mixture.
- Cook, stirring occasionally, until shrimp just turn pink, 2-3 min.**
- Divide creamy shrimp stew between bowls.
- Sprinkle Parmesan cheese over top.
- Sprinkle with chili flakes, if desired.
